Styling Ideas for Bedroom Clocks
· Wall Clocks Above the Bed: A large clock above the headboard creates a bold focal point.
· Minimalist Table Clocks: Sleek designs on bedside tables offer simplicity and elegance.
· Vintage Designs: Wooden or classic-style clocks bring warmth to traditional bedrooms.
· Silent Clocks: For light sleepers, non-ticking clocks ensure peaceful rest.
When selecting, consider scale and placement. Small rooms benefit from minimalist designs, while spacious bedrooms can carry larger statement clocks.

Tips for Choosing the Right Clock
· Match Décor Style: Minimalist for modern rooms, vintage for traditional, or metallic for contemporary luxury.
· Size Appropriateness: Ensure the clock’s size complements the wall or furniture.
· Silent Mechanisms: Opt for silent sweep movements to maintain restful sleep environments.
· Color Harmony: Blend with wall tones or contrast for visual impact.
